Answer: The president chooses who will be prime minister

Step-by-step explanation:

France has a President and also has a Prime Minister. It is the responsibility of the president to appoint the prime minister.

The president holds the highest office and us regarded as the head of state. The prime minister has real power in government as the French Parliament is his responsibility.
